The Product Engineer for Recovery Boiler Applications is responsible for providing technical expertise, product development support, and engineering guidance related to recovery boiler equipment, systems, and solutions. This role bridges customer needs, product design, and field performance—ensuring that the organization’s recovery boiler technologies meet safety, efficiency, reliability, and regulatory expectations. The engineer supports sales, project execution, and aftermarket service with deep knowledge of kraft recovery processes and related equipment performance.

Product Technical Ownership

  • Support development and refinement of product specifications, design standards, and engineering guidelines.
  • Evaluate boiler performance data from customers and field teams to guide product improvements.

Engineering & Application Support

  • Provide technical recommendations for boiler upgrades, rebuilds, and optimization packages.
  • Assist with equipment sizing, thermal calculations, and process design for air systems, heat transfer surfaces, smelt systems, sootblowers, ESPs, and related components.
  • Benchmark competitive technologies and incorporate best practices into product design.

Customer & Sales Support

  • Participate in customer meetings to translate requirements into engineered solutions.
  • Support proposal development with technical inputs, equipment selections, and performance models.
  • Deliver technical presentations, training, and product demonstrations.

Field & Aftermarket Support

  • Support field service teams on inspections, troubleshooting, and root‑cause investigations.
  • Develop upgrade packages for air systems, combustion optimization, fouling mitigation, and pressure‑part enhancements.

What you’ll need

  •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ering, Chemical Engineering, Pulp & Paper Science, or related discipline required.
  • Experience in recovery boilers, chemical recovery, power & utilities, or heavy industrial steam generation.
  • Experience with OEM engineering, process design, or field service support preferred.
  • Knowledge of kraft recovery processes, combustion systems, smelt dissolution, and heat transfer fundamentals.
  • Familiarity with boiler pressure part design, fluid dynamics, air system optimization, and emissions control equipment.
  • Ability to interpret engineering drawings, 3D models, and field inspection reports.
